Changelog 3.2.0 — Pinpointly address autocomplete widget. We renamed AUTOCOMPLETE_TOKEN to something less ambiguous after the incident review flagged it as easy to confuse with the public widget token. The old name still works but logs a loud deprecation warning and will be dropped in 4.0. Security reviewers: the renamed setting gates server-side lookups against the Wayfield geocoder, so treat it as a full secret, not a publishable key. To migrate, remove the old entry from your .env and add the new line below.

vault entry, kawep-yahof: LEDGER_TOKEN29=aed31a7c3a275025cbea1ab2c10a7

Ticket: BLM-418 — Bloom filter config drift in front of Cinderkeep KV

The Sievegate bloom filter in prod has drifted from what's in the repo. False-positive rate on staging is ~1%, but prod is serving with a smaller bit array and fewer hash rounds, causing extra KV lookups and roughly 12% added read latency. Someone hand-edited the prod config during the March incident and never backported it. Requesting review of a patch that re-aligns prod to source. For comparison, the live values are below.

service settings:
[casax]
port = 6379
team = rusir
host = casax.zemvarhq.corp
region = outer-4
access_code = ac_9808ce
timeout_ms = 1500

### Timetabler v4.8.2 — Key Rotation

The signing key used for ClassWeave solver bundles was rotated as part of the quarterly schedule. Schools running on-prem installs will see signature verification failures for any bundle downloaded after this release until the new key is imported. Old bundles remain verifiable with the retired key until end of term. Support should direct admins to the standard import procedure. The new public signing key follows.

release key, yagap-kagag: bky6_1ks93y

## Escalation

If the Sproutly scheduler misses two consecutive watering windows, first verify the cron lease in the Greenhouse coordinator before paging anyone. A single missed window is tolerable; two indicates the lease-renewal bug we patched in release 4.2 may have regressed. Reviewers should confirm any escalation change preserves the 15-minute grace period. For urgent escalations, reach the duty gardener-ops engineer at the address below.

escalation mailbox, yafog-kafof: eliok@xolmarcloud.local